Sparrevohn LRRS Airport (PASV/SVW) is a United States Air Force military airstrip located in a remote area of Alaska, and it is not open for public use. Consequently, there are no traditional traveler reviews or experiences available regarding commercial flights, terminal facilities, security wait times, or transportation connections. The airport's primary mission is to provide access to the Sparrevohn Long Range Radar Site for servicing, supply runs, and transferring civilian contractors and military personnel.
